Minneopa State Park showcases a diverse landscape featuring cascading waterfalls and varied ecosystems including prairies, woodlands, and wetlands. The park contains multiple hiking trails that traverse these different habitats, providing visitors opportunities to observe local flora and fauna in their natural environment. The park serves as an important ecological site in Minnesota, supporting numerous bird species that make it a notable destination for birdwatching enthusiasts.
Bald eagles and various songbirds can be observed throughout the park depending on the season. Designated picnic areas are available for visitors seeking recreational opportunities. Minneopa State Park represents a significant natural area in Minnesota's state park system, offering both recreational activities and natural habitat preservation.
The park's combination of geological features, including its waterfall system, and ecological diversity makes it a representative example of Minnesota's natural landscapes.

Discover the History of the Land at the Blue Earth County Historical Society
The Blue Earth County Historical Society serves as a gateway to understanding the rich history of the region. As you step into the society's museum, you are greeted by exhibits that chronicle the area's past, from its early Native American inhabitants to the settlers who shaped its development. The artifacts on display provide a tangible connection to history, allowing you to appreciate the stories that have unfolded over generations.
Engaging with knowledgeable staff members can enhance your experience, as they share insights and anecdotes that bring the exhibits to life. In addition to its permanent collections, the Blue Earth County Historical Society hosts various events and programs throughout the year. These activities often include lectures, workshops, and guided tours that delve deeper into specific historical topics.
Participating in these events allows you to gain a more comprehensive understanding of the local heritage while connecting with others who share your interest in history. The society's commitment to preserving and sharing the past ensures that visitors leave with a greater appreciation for the land and its significance.

Experience the Arts at the Carnegie Art Center
The Carnegie Art Center stands as a testament to the vibrant arts scene in the area. As you enter this historic building, you are welcomed by an array of artistic expressions that reflect both local talent and broader artistic movements. The center features rotating exhibitions that showcase works from various artists, providing an opportunity to discover new perspectives and styles.
You may find yourself inspired by the creativity on display, whether it be through paintings, sculptures, or mixed media installations. In addition to exhibitions, the Carnegie Art Center offers workshops and classes for individuals of all skill levels. Engaging in these programs allows you to explore your own artistic abilities while learning from experienced instructors.
The center often collaborates with local artists to provide unique experiences that foster creativity within the community. By participating in events at the Carnegie Art Center, you not only support local artists but also contribute to a thriving cultural landscape.

Take a Stroll Along the Red Jacket Trail
The Red Jacket Trail offers a scenic pathway perfect for leisurely strolls or invigorating bike rides. As you traverse this well-maintained trail, you will be surrounded by picturesque landscapes that change with the seasons. The trail meanders through wooded areas, open fields, and alongside waterways, providing ample opportunities for nature observation.
You may encounter various wildlife species along your journey, adding an element of surprise to your outdoor adventure. The Red Jacket Trail is also an excellent choice for those seeking a peaceful escape from daily life. The gentle sounds of nature create a calming backdrop as you walk or cycle at your own pace.
Benches placed along the trail invite you to pause and take in your surroundings while enjoying fresh air and sunshine. Whether you are looking for exercise or simply wish to unwind in nature, this trail offers an inviting space for all.
